CitiusTech appoints experienced technology exec as CEO 

Rajan Kohli, CEO, CitiusTech

CitiusTech Healthcare Technology on Monday announced that its Board of Directors appointed Rajan Kohli, an experienced technology executive as chief executive officer. Kohli is succeeding Bhaskar Sambasivan who is stepping away from the CEO role for personal reasons.

Kohli joins the Princeton-based health care technology services form from Wipro, a global leader in technology services and solutions, where he spent nearly three decades and was responsible for $6 billion in annual revenues. He most recently served as the president of the iDEAS (Integrated Digital, Engineering and Application Services) business, supporting clients globally across industry segments. He has held a variety of leadership positions at Wipro, including head of Banking & Financial Services and chief marketing officer. Kohli also founded and scaled Wipro Digital in the decade before taking over leadership of the iDEAS global business line.

Established in 2005, CitiusTech develops software and technology solutions for over 140 leading health care and life sciences organizations, including large health care providers, payers, pharmaceutical organizations and medical technology companies.

CitiusTech recently acquired Wilco Source, a specialist in Salesforce solutions and services, to strengthen its patient and member-centric digital offerings. The company is owned by Bain Capital Private Equity and BPEA EQT, along with CitiusTech co-founders Rizwan Koita & Jagdish Moorjani.
